Analysis

Ukraine recorded 10.33 for pupil-teacher ratio, tertiary in 2018. That is the lowest value across all 22 years on record.

The figure is down 1.1% on the previous year and down 27.3% over ten years.

Over the whole period, pupil-teacher ratio, tertiary in Ukraine peaked at 14.32 in 2007 and was at its lowest, 10.33, in 2018.

That places Ukraine 140th out of 175 countries with data for 2018, putting it in the bottom qu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 22 years of available data.
